The State Of Maryland ‘Registers The Nation's First’ Artificial Intelligence Project Management Apprenticeship
The State of Maryland Apprenticeship and Training Council has registered the first Registered Apprenticeship in the United States dedicated to Artificial Intelligence (AI) Project Management - a two-year paid pathway into leading AI deployment inside organizations. The sponsor is Master of Project Academy, a Project Management Training Provider founded in 2012. Chris Monroe, who serves as CEO of the Master of Project Academy, said: "Every company deploying AI needs people on its own payroll accountable for that last mile - across every vendor and every model type. This Apprenticeship builds them the way Skilled Professions have always been built: Paid, mentored and on the job." The program pairs 4,000 hours of mentored on-the-job learning with 340 hours of related instruction - 219 of them AI-specific - and is registered under the U.S. Department of Labor Occupation Information Technology Project Manager. Apprentices are full-time W-2 Employees of participating employers from day one - paid employment, not tuition.
